India Experiences Increase in Covid Cases Amid New Variant Detection

India has witnessed a significant rise in Covid-19 infections recently, with over 750 new cases reported within just one week. Health officials link this surge partly to the emergence of two distinct variants, which may be influencing transmission patterns across several regions. The Union Health Ministry has called upon residents to strictly adhere to recommended safety guidelines, emphasizing that vigilance remains crucial as viral dynamics shift unpredictably. States are being encouraged to intensify genomic sequencing efforts for early detection and rapid response against these emerging strains.

To counteract rising infections, authorities have introduced several initiatives including:

  • Expanded Testing: Targeted testing campaigns focusing on hotspots aim at early case identification.
  • Public Education Drives: Campaigns promoting booster vaccinations seek to enhance community immunity.
  • Healthcare Capacity Enhancement: Strengthening hospital readiness ensures adequate care availability if hospitalizations increase.

Key Preventive Measures and Updated Vaccination Guidelines Amid Increasing Case Numbers

With infection rates climbing once again across various Indian states,it becomes imperative that individuals adopt comprehensive protective behaviors aimed at limiting viral spread.Health agencies recommend adhering strictly to these precautions:

  • Mask Usage : Wearing masks consistently indoors or where crowds gather significantly reduces airborne transmission risks.
  • Hand Hygiene : Frequent handwashing with soap or use of alcohol-based sanitizers (minimum 60% alcohol) disrupts pathogen transfer.
  • Physical Distancing :

    Maintaining safe distances from non-household members especially in enclosed spaces lowers exposure probability.

  • Improved Ventilation :

    Ensuring adequate airflow indoors dilutes concentration levels of infectious aerosols.
